08.12.2009 Information Day at CSTU organised by the Office for Entrepreneurial Activities Support
On 8 December, 2009 the Office for Entrepreneurial Activities Support of CSTU organised an information day “Innovations in Education”. About 80 participants, the representatives of the regional higher education institutions, state administration and business environment, visited the event. The rector of CSTU, Prof. Yuri Lega, and the vice rector and the Head of the Office, Prof. Tamara Kachala, welcomed the participants.
The members of the Office presented the activities and services of the Office and the new Innovative Centre of Student Practical Training and Employment.

02.12.2009 Adoption of the "Policy Paper"
Having learnt different experience, the group of local experts representing all interested parties (Universities, businesses, governmental bodies) developed a special policy paper (“white paper”) which was adopted by the Ministry of Education of Ukraine. This should lead to improvements in the regulation of innovative activities in Higher Education.

01.12.2009 Innovative Centre of Student Practical Training and Employment
In December, 2009 an Innovative Centre of Student Practical Training and Employment was created in CSTU. The idea of the establishment of such a Centre in CSTU resulted from the inter project coaching visit of the members of the Office for Entrepreneurial Activities to CARE project "Career & Employability Centre" in May 2009.

26.10.2009 Signing a cooperation agreement, Alicante, Spain
On 12 to 16 October, 2009 Mr Lega (Rector of Cherkasy State Technological University), Mrs. Kachala (Prorector of the University) and two members of staff of the Office visited University of Alicante. During the visit Mr. Lega and Mr. Ignacio Jimenez Raneda (President of University of Alicante) signed a cooperation agreement. Also, they discussed the issues which are relevant to technology transfer and entrepreneurial activities at both Universities. It was decided to continue the cooperation between two Universities in the framework of European projects.

13-14.11.2008 The VII all-Russian scientific conference on "Planning and Securing of Staff Training for the Industrial and Economic Sector of the Region"
On 13-14 November, 2008 a partner from the PROTECT consortium, the St. Petersburg State Electrotechnical University (LETI), arranged the VII all-Russian scientific conference on "Planning and Securing of Staff Training for the Industrial and Economic Sector of the Region". The conference took place in the Big Conference Hall of the University. The second day the delegates spent on the premises of one of the biggest enterprise in the city OJSC “Svetlana”. 103 delegates were registered for the event.
The local coordinator, Prof. Dr. Tamara Kachala, was invited to take part in the conference and to give a presentation “Professional Security as a Basic for the Development of the Industrial Sector in Ukraine”. Her participation at the conference Prof. Dr. Kachala financed on Cherkasy University’s own account. A staff member of the Office, Ms. Arestova, took part in the conference, too.
The participation in the conference was a good opportunity to enhance the networking of the projects’ partners.

19.09.2008 Letter of Support from the Ministry of Economic Affairs:
On 9th September 2008, the Minister of Economic Affairs of Ukraine, Mr. Bohdan M. Danylyshyn, signed an official letter, in which he confirmed that the Ministry will support the objectives and activities of the PROTECT project.
It is emphasised that the project reinforces links between universities, industry and authorities. This project gives an opportunity to identify the problems of research community and combine efforts for the promotion of innovative activities in Ukraine. The success of such a project can be achieved only by integrating all players on the national level. There is another aspect which is considered to be vital. The Office for technology transfer and entrepreneurial activities support will be established in Cherkasy region. Unlike the situation in the capital, where numerous business projects and programmes are successfully running and receive considerable support from central state authorities, the situation in the region needs a set of urgent measures aimed at creating effective mechanism of technology transfer from university research to business and facilitating innovative activities of enterprises. That’s why the project is focused on setting up the system of support in the typical regional higher educational establishment – Cherkasy State Technological University, and thus wants to pass on the obtained experiences to other regions in the country.
By this letter, the PROTECT project gained acknowledgement on the national political level.

15.09.2008 Entrepreneurial Day at Saarland University
On 15th of September 2008, the Contact Centre for Technology Transfer at Saarland University (KWT) organized the 6th Entrepreneurial Day at Saarland University. This year the topic of the event was "Evaluation of the company and the company's succession in practice". The representatives of governmental bodies, business and academic environment from the Saarland region were invited to take part in the event (please see the agenda of the event).
As the staff members of the Office for Technology Transfer at Cherkassy State Technological University attended at the same time a training workshop in the framework of the PROTECT project, they also participated with great interest in the Entrepreneurial Day at Saarland University.
12.09.2008 "Deutsche Welle" Interview about PROTECT
After the German Academic Exchange Service (DAAD) in Ukraine published a short text about the PROTECT project on its web page, Germany's international broadcaster “Deutsche Welle” interviewed the Local Coordinator of the project, Mrs Tamara Kachala (Cherkasy State Technological University). She reported on the objectives and activities of the project. It is emphasized that PROTECT opens up new vistas for young people and university graduates who want to start up their own business. In the framework of the project, an Office for Technology Transfer will be established at Cherkasy State Technological University. The Office's main activities are the support of entrepreneurial activities in higher education as well as the promotion of University-Business links.
